WebMost mold-related health issues arise from spore exposure, mostly by inhalation. At first, mold growth on a wall may seem harmless. However, upon maturation, mold releases many thousands of airborne spores. These spores float in the air and are inhaled by humans and animals daily. They are usually dealt with promptly by the immune system.
WebJul 28, 2016 · Phoma is reported as a fungus involved in type I allergies (hay fever, asthma) and may cause type III hypersensitivity pneumonitis {3870; 989}. Allergic sensitisation to Phoma is more prevalent in the atopic … pippa windsor physioWebInterpretive Data.
